I cannot receive HD on most of our channels. I do get a few but very few. I talked to a Dish tech and he ran some info and suggested I have a tech come out. We are in the RV and that would not work. We are 200 hundred miles from home. I do get all my channels in standard TV. The on line tech said I was not getting sat 129 and that is where all most all HD channels are. I thought all I had to bring in is Sat 110 and 119?

The tech is correct. On your dish 129 is on the right. 119 in middle and 110 on left. Do you have the 3 lnb dish? That is what you need. Jerry

Are you on Directv? On DirecTV you have to have the 101 sat to get everything else. When I worked for DirecTV installing I lined up on the 101, once you have the 101 sat, if you have the tilt right, then the other two will come in automatically if there isn't some obstruction, AND your LNB is working and your box it working properly. What are you getting on your sat meters strength for each sat? 1.Check sat meters 2.Check for obstructions, (trees) 3.Check dish tilt. After that if everything so far doesn't fix it, wait for the tech.

Just in case someone has Direct TV versus Dish network here is a problem I had.
My HD has B band converters. These are connected inline on to the satellite cable and go on the back of the receiver.
My receiver is a DVR so has two inputs. One of the converters failed and would not pass the HD. I switched them and the issue followed. Replacing the converter solved the problem.
